Lamborghini Veneno - bonkers hypercar

The new Lamborghini Veneno makes the McLaren P1 and Ferrari LaFerrari look pedestrian.  The Veneno is a super exclusive and super expensive track-oriented but street legal supercar that will cost £3million ($4.5million)

Only three Venenos will be made and it's safe to say they will be snapped up pretty quickly.  The engine is a 6.5 litre V12 that produces 740bhp - and that's it.  Lamborghini haven't released any more information but if 0-60mph isn't less than 3 seconds and top speed less than 200mph we'll change our name to Fastprimate.

The Veneno's bodywork is a riot of creases and slashes and downforce is incorporated into all of them.   Air is encouraged to travel over the car, and under via it's flat underside and rear diffuser - sucking the Veneno to the ground at speed.

The name Veneno derives from an apparently famous, and speedy, bull from the 1950s.
